Bahrain Clinches Double Victory at Gulf Green Mobility Forum Awards

Manama: The Kingdom of Bahrain secured two prestigious awards at the Gulf Green Mobility Forum 2026 during a ceremony held in Salalah, Sultanate of Oman.

According to Bahrain News Agency, Dr. Shaikh Abdulla bin Ahmed Al Khalifa, the Minister of Transportation and Telecommunications, accepted the Sustainable Organisation Award on behalf of Khalifa Bin Salman Port. The award was presented by His Highness Sayyid Marwan bin Turki Al Said, Governor of Dhofar, with Bader Hood Al Mahmood, Undersecretary for Ports and Maritime Affairs, in attendance.

Fatima Abdulla Al Dhaen, Undersecretary for Land Transportation and Postal Affairs, was honored with the Leading Woman in Mobility Award. Dr. Shaikh Abdulla emphasized that these achievements underscore Bahrain's commitment to fostering a sustainable and innovative transport system. This initiative aims to reduce emissions and enhance resource and energy efficiency, aligning with the Kingdom's sustainability and carbon neutrality goals.

Khalifa Bin Salman Port was recognized for its initiatives in sustainability and carbon reduction, highlighting a solar energy project that utilizes panels installed at port facilities. This initiative provides clean, renewable energy and boosts operational efficiency.

Al Dhaen's recognition with the Leading Woman in Mobility Award reflects her significant contributions to sustainable land transport, institutional governance, and sustainability. Her efforts in innovation, national talent and youth development, and promoting women's participation in the transport and logistics sector were key factors in her accolade.
